我有一个表格,我通过ajax提交。我使用的是jquery表单插件。我正在尝试做的是获取从我的服务器返回的'Location‘头。我可以在firebug中看到它。但是每当我在成功的回调中调用getResponseHeader()函数时,它总是返回‘undefined’。
代码:
form.ajaxForm({
dataType: 'xml',
data: {format: 'xml'},
resetForm: true,
success: function(xml,status,xhr){
var location = xhr.getResponseHeader('Location');
alert(location);
});
位置未定义。但我可以在firebug中看到'Location‘头。我遗漏了什么?即使我从xhr对象调用getAllResponseHeaders(),它也会返回'undefined‘
https://stackoverflow.com/questions/4369987
复制相似问题